#91988c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#91988c is composed of 56.9% red, 59.6%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.9%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 95 degrees, a saturation of 5.5% and a lightness of 57.3%. #91988c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#233119.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

● #91988c color description : Dark grayish green.
The hexadecimal color #91988c has RGB values of R:145, G:152,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9541772.
